On resume from suspend the following chain of events can happen:
A rt5682_resume() -> mod_delayed_work() for jack_detect_work
B DAPM sequence starts ( DAPM is locked now)
A1. rt5682_jack_detect_handler() scheduled
- Takes both jdet_mutex and calibrate_mutex
- Calls in to rt5682_headset_detect() which tries to take DAPM lock, it
starts to wait for it as B path took it already.
B1. DAPM sequence reaches the "HP Amp", rt5682_hp_event() tries to take
the jdet_mutex, but it is locked in A1, so it waits.
Deadlock.
To solve the deadlock, drop the jdet_mutex, use the jack_detect_work to do
the jack removal handling, move the dapm lock up one level to protect the
most of the rt5682_jack_detect_handler(), but not the jack reporting as it
might trigger a DAPM sequence.
The rt5682_headset_detect() can be changed to static as well.

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
